London property developer Avanton has launched a £500m fund to build new rental homes in the capital.
The company said the fund will be used to buy land in inner London boroughs and deliver 5,000 build-to-rent homes by 2023, in a vote of confidence in the city’s recovery after Covid.
It said that “despite the obvious challenges the property market has been extremely resilient and recovered rapidly last year after the lockdown”.
Avanton will target sites with land values of between £20m and £100m in areas including Islington, Southwark, Wandsworth, Wimbledon, Hammersmith, Lambeth, Camden and Brent.
Each development will provide between 300 to 1,000 homes.
